
oxygen desaturation
Oxygen desaturation refers to a decrease in the level of oxygen in the blood. Normally, blood oxygen levels should be around 95-100%. When these levels drop, it can lead to symptoms like shortness of breath, confusion, or fatigue. This can occur due to various reasons, such as lung diseases, heart conditions, high altitudes, or obstructed airways. Monitoring oxygen levels is important, especially in medical situations, as severe desaturation can be life-threatening and may require interventions like supplemental oxygen or breathing assistance. Understanding and addressing oxygen desaturation is crucial for maintaining health and wellbeing.
